Balu Anand (1954 – 3 June 2016) was an Indian actor and director who worked in Tamil-language films (Kollywood). He appeared in over 100 films as an actor and directed several films, such as Naane Raja Naane Mandhiri, Annanagar Mudhal Theru and Unakkaga Piranthen.[1][2][3][4]
Career
Anand is known as the director of successful films Naane Raja Naane Mandhiri starring Vijayakanth and the Sathyaraj, Radha, Ambika starrer Annanagar Mudhal Theru, a remake of Malayalam film Gandhinagar 2nd Street.[5]
In the early 2000s, Anand attempted to make a comeback through two films as a director, Paapoo...Paapoo and Low Class Loganathan, but neither film was theatrically released.[6] His last directorial venture Anandha Thollai starring Powerstar Srinivasan is still unreleased.[7]
Death
Anand died of a heart attack in his home town of Kalampalayam.[8][9]
